RenewCred Secures ₹4.15 Crore Seed Funding for India's First Digital Carbon Credit Standard

CARBON CAPTURE

RenewCred, a climate-technology company based in India, has closed a seed funding round of ₹4.15 crore to establish a digital carbon credit standard and registry for the voluntary carbon market. The funding round was led by Campus Angels Network, with participation from multiple investors including Kairos Early Opportunity Fund and ACT Capital Foundation.

Founded by Abhimanyu Rathi and a leadership team focused on high-integrity carbon credits, RenewCred aims to remove 2.0 gigatons of greenhouse gas emissions over the next 14 years. The company plans to issue its first carbon credits this quarter, addressing structural issues in carbon markets such as lack of trust and slow verification processes. RenewCred focuses on non-nature-based methodologies and aims to create a credible infrastructure for carbon credits in India.
